Dear Rashmi,
First you can activate your UAN through UAN Member Portal. Then you can update your KYC like Aadhar, PAN, Bank account details. After successful update of your KYC it will be approved by your employer in epf employer portal through Digital Signature.
After successful approval from your employer you can apply PF advance claim in your UAN member portal. Its all about online claim using Aadhar. Otherwise
You can apply through manual with claim Form through Non Aadhar Seeding which is available in online. Fill the form and get signature from your employer with authorized seal. You can attached aadhar, PAN and Bank passbook copy with the manual form and submit to PF office.
